An open API service indexing awesome lists of open source software.

Shell

A shell is a text-based terminal, used for manipulating programs and files. Shell scripts typically manage program execution.

https://github.com/wszqkzqk/shellhistoryconvert

A tool to convert shell history between bash, written in vala.

bash shell zsh

Last synced: 12 May 2026

https://github.com/sofisar/c_fat32-info-extraction_fall-2023

This program takes in a FAT32.img file and creates a shell, where several commands can be used to extract information about the FAT32 image.

c fat32 fat32-extraction shell

Last synced: 06 May 2026

https://github.com/mmapro12/turkman

Turkman, Linux komutlarının man sayfalarını Türkçeye çevirir ve zenginleştirir. Turkman, Türkçe içerik eksikliğini gidererek, Linux kullanıcıları için daha erişilebilir bir deneyim sunmayı hedefler.

gnu gplv3 linux open-source python shell translation turkish

Last synced: 10 Oct 2025

https://github.com/maxgfr/claude-code-switch

Minimal, zero-dependency provider switching for Claude Code — switch between Anthropic, OpenRouter, DeepSeek, Z.AI, Kimi, Qwen, MiniMax and custom endpoints

ai anthropic claude claude-code cli deepseek glm homebrew kimi llm minimax model-switching openrouter posix provider qwen shell zai

Last synced: 23 Jun 2026

https://github.com/henomis/ai-shell-go

Ai shell helper written in go

ai chatgpt go openai shell

Last synced: 06 May 2026

https://github.com/gimwonbae/myshell

Making Shell using C Lang

shell system-programming

Last synced: 12 May 2026

https://github.com/givensuman/fish-copyutils

some fish plugins for copying stuff

fish-plugin shell

Last synced: 12 May 2026

https://github.com/eavelasquez/learning-blockchain

This is a project to learn about blockchain technology and how it can be used to create a blockchain.

babel blockchain cryptojs elliptic express javascript jest nodejs shell unit-test websocket yarn

Last synced: 12 Mar 2025

https://github.com/jakethesillysnake/linuxmonitoring

Simple bash scripts for Ubuntu system overview.

bash bash-script linux linux-shell shell shell-script ubuntu

Last synced: 06 May 2026

https://github.com/olivergondza/openrc-manager

Manage your OpenStack authentication files with ease

openrc openstack shell

Last synced: 16 Mar 2025

https://github.com/towaquimbayo/comp-4736

BCIT Computer Systems Technology (CST) - COMP 4736 (Intro to Operating Systems)

c cpp memory-allocation memory-cache memory-management operating-system os shell shell-script thread threading

Last synced: 06 May 2026

https://github.com/syssos/simple_shell

This Shell was written in C, and used as a learning method to better understand how a Linux based shell operates.

c linux shell

Last synced: 06 May 2026

https://github.com/vidyasagaryadav499/custom-terminal-guide

A personal collection of Terminal customizations, including scripts, themes, and configuration files to enhance and personalize the Terminal experience.

bash configs customization dotfiles gitbash gitbash-theme linux powershell shell shell-scripts terminal terminal-themes themes windows

Last synced: 19 Jan 2026

https://github.com/xeferis/cleanzip

A zsh plugin to compress files without not needed data. Made for MacOS.

clean compress oh-my-zsh oh-my-zsh-plugin ohmyzsh plugin shell terminal zip zsh zsh-plugin

Last synced: 06 May 2026

https://github.com/purag/spackle

:package: a simple module system for bash scripts

import modularization namespace shell

Last synced: 10 Oct 2025

https://github.com/gufranco/tmux-sensible-revamped

Sensible tmux defaults normalized across every tmux version (1.9+), OS, and terminal. Truecolor, OSC52 clipboard, undercurl, bug fixes. Non-destructive, 95%+ tested

bash clipboard configuration dotfiles osc52 sensible-defaults shell terminal tmux tmux-plugin tmux-sensible tpm truecolor

Last synced: 24 Jun 2026

https://github.com/gufranco/tmux-pomodoro-revamped

A Pomodoro timer in the tmux status bar with zero temp files: the work/break timeline is pure math over a start epoch, all state in tmux options. Pause/resume, notifications, 95%+ tested

bash dotfiles focus pomodoro productivity shell status-bar timer tmux tmux-plugin tpm

Last synced: 24 Jun 2026

https://github.com/simplyyan/weepsbox

The former Worldeepside tool (which no longer exists) is now an extensive independent open-source toolbox.

batch batch-script downloader package-management package-manager shell shell-script shell-scripting shellscript

Last synced: 27 Mar 2025

https://github.com/aymen-haddaji-hub/unix_go_shell

Go implementation of the Unix command line interpreter

go linux linux-shell shell unix

Last synced: 14 Jan 2026

https://github.com/scaraux/42sh

📟 Bash like Shell developed during my second year of studies, in C.

bash c shell

Last synced: 07 May 2026

https://github.com/saumya-sarkhel/shell-script

Shell Script programs

shell shell-script

Last synced: 10 Oct 2025

https://github.com/audibleblink/y

Because reading zsh documentation is apparently harder than writing Rust

dotfiles joke rtfm shell zsh zsh-plugins

Last synced: 07 May 2026

https://github.com/rvk007/my-shell

A custom simplified version of Unix shell.

c cshell custom-shell shell unix-shell

Last synced: 07 May 2026

https://github.com/kakwa/trc

tar revision control

revision shell tar vcs

Last synced: 25 Mar 2025

https://github.com/zibri/wshell3

Webshell in nodejs

remote shell xterm

Last synced: 10 Jan 2026

https://github.com/kyhyco/kysh

battery included zsh experience

cli productivity shell terminal zsh zsh-configuation

Last synced: 07 May 2026

https://github.com/namberino/namsh

The minimalist shell

c shell

Last synced: 07 May 2026

https://github.com/gufranco/tmux-time-revamped

Local clock and world clocks for tmux, each timezone colored by time of day. Non-blocking, no temp files, 95%+ tested

bash clock dotfiles shell status-bar statusline terminal timezone tmux tmux-plugin tpm world-clock

Last synced: 24 Jun 2026

https://github.com/mackenzie779/rewriteauthoringithistory-script

a shell script to rewrite the author of past commits in your git repo

author commit git shell shell-script

Last synced: 10 Mar 2026

https://github.com/gufranco/tmux-launcher-revamped

Launch any TUI app (lazygit, yazi, lf, k9s, htop) in a tmux popup or window from the current pane path. Configurable per app, popup gated to 3.2 with window fallback, 95%+ tested

bash display-popup dotfiles launcher lazygit popup shell terminal tmux tmux-plugin tpm tui yazi

Last synced: 24 Jun 2026

https://github.com/drew-chase/mush

A fully cross-platform shell interpreter and drop-in replacement for PowerShell, BASH, and ZSH

command-line-utilities cross-platform shell terminal tui

Last synced: 14 Apr 2026

https://github.com/gitkenetic/my-configs

Personal configuration files for Git, shell, and IDEs

config dotfiles shell

Last synced: 07 May 2026

https://github.com/huberp/yaml2env

projects content of a yaml file into the shell environment of unix shell or windows powershell.

cli environment golang phu-tools shell yaml

Last synced: 07 May 2026

https://github.com/ptonelli/mcp-shell

a set of mcp tools to host on your own server with a shell and a few python helpers

git mcp-server python3 shell

Last synced: 07 May 2026

https://github.com/mikeludemann/angular-install-script

Installing angular with bash

angular bash shell

Last synced: 07 May 2026

https://github.com/ju1ius/pointenv

Polyglot dotenv parser and evaluator for NodeJS

dotenv dotenv-parser nodejs posix shell

Last synced: 07 May 2026

https://github.com/d-w-arnold/aws-scripts-examples

Scripts for an AWS eco-system, to support: Examples of Infrastructure as Code (IaC) source code, using AWS CDK.

aws-cli boto3 python3 shell

Last synced: 01 Apr 2025

https://github.com/gauravcodepro/json-github

json parser for the github repository parse. Given the source code of the github it will make the direct clone address of the github reporitories.

configuration-files docker github github-pages kubernetes shell

Last synced: 28 Apr 2026

https://github.com/nelsonmatenda/minishell

Projecto é sobre criar um simples shell. Com foco a aprender muito sobre processos e file descriptors

42cursus 42luanda 42projects bash c minishell shell

Last synced: 07 May 2026

https://github.com/husen-hn/ffmpeg-android-binary

🎬 Android FFmpeg Builder - Automated FFmpeg shared library (.so) builder for Android. Supports multiple architectures, optimized configuration, and includes pre-built binaries.

android automation build-script ffmpeg media-processing ndk shared-libraries shell

Last synced: 07 May 2026

https://github.com/src-run/bash-bright-library

The bright-library provides a light weight collection of bash functions to enable basic console output styling.

bash bash-color bash-colors bash-script bash-scripting bash-scripts bright-library color color-formats colors console console-color console-library shell shell-script shell-scripting shell-scripts

Last synced: 07 May 2026

https://github.com/eq-desktop/eqsh

Your Polished AIO Hyprland Shell. Built for maximum efficiency and a better workflow

control-center dock hyprland linux macos notch notifications quickshell ricing shell system-tray

Last synced: 07 May 2026

https://github.com/lakshaybhushan/laksh-unixshell

A basic unix shell made in C language

c linux shell

Last synced: 07 May 2026

https://github.com/cbdefontenay/heimdal-shell

Heimdal is a simple Shell

chat chat-application linux rust shell

Last synced: 07 May 2026

https://github.com/meowlove/lisk

Quickly initialize and configure your Linux system with LISK: a simple, secure, and extensible setup toolkit. Automate essential tasks and customize your setup with ease.

admin auto-config automation bash configuration deployment devops initialization linux linux-init-setup-kit lisk management script server setup shell sysadmin system toolkit

Last synced: 14 Apr 2026

https://github.com/mikeludemann/azure-installing-script

Installing Azure CLI with bash

azure bash cli shell

Last synced: 13 Apr 2026

https://github.com/ahmadyousif89/simple_shell

ALX | Shell Interpreter - C

c shell

Last synced: 29 Jun 2026

https://github.com/jaiprotocol/pub3-shell

Безопасная GUI-оболочка для запуска Pub3 и ЖАИ

ai-shell automation gui markdown packing pub3 safe-launch shell

Last synced: 07 May 2026

https://github.com/aintnodev/renpaste

does what it says

linux renpy shell

Last synced: 10 May 2026

https://github.com/akornatskyy/backscribe

🔄 Backup + scribe (a shell script writer).

backup-script shell

Last synced: 04 Mar 2026

https://github.com/Lusan-sapkota/smart-shell

Smart‑Shell is an intelligent terminal assistant that converts natural language into executable Bash or Zsh commands.

bash cli cli-agent gemini localagent python shell zsh

Last synced: 01 Apr 2026

https://github.com/loglux/openwebui-docker-automation

This repository contains automation scripts for managing OpenWebUI and pipeline components using Docker. It simplifies updates, resets, and ensures containers are healthy

ai automation automation-scripts bash containers deployment docker docker-auto-build docker-automated-build docker-automation gpu nas openwebui openwebui-pipe pipelines postgres self-hosting shell shell-script

Last synced: 17 Apr 2026

https://github.com/mountaineerbr/shelldatediff

Calculate time differences with shell builtins. Check moon phases, Easter dates and next Friday 13th.

bash date-calculation datediff easter-calculation ksh lunar-phases shell time-interval zsh

Last synced: 01 Apr 2026

https://github.com/symonmuchemi/alx-system_engineering-devops

This project is part of the ALX_SE engineering curriculum

bash devops scripting shell

Last synced: 17 Apr 2026

https://github.com/niinpatel/basic-shell-scripting

If statements, While loops, Switch Case, Random Numbers and More using shell scripting.

bash scripting shell unix

Last synced: 05 Mar 2026

https://github.com/m7moudgadallah/alx-system_engineering-devops

alx_africa 0x00. Shell, basics task

alx-africa command-line shell

Last synced: 29 Mar 2026

https://github.com/felipefacundes/test_file_type

The test_file_type script is a versatile and multilingual utility designed to analyze and report detailed information about a given file. This tool can identify various file types, including directories, symbolic links, pipes, character/block devices, sockets, and regular files.

file files shell shell-script shell-scripts shellscript test test-file test-files tests

Last synced: 02 Jun 2026

https://github.com/pilgrimtabby/orwell

Block and unblock websites to maximize your productivity (MacOS and Linux).

bash bash-script dns linux macos productivity productivity-booster shell shell-script

Last synced: 17 Apr 2026

https://github.com/victorpaularony/visualizations

this website displays artists details and band details

css3 golang html5 javascript script shell spotify

Last synced: 17 Apr 2026

https://github.com/vncsmyrnk/compgen

Shell completions generator.

completions shell zsh

Last synced: 03 Jun 2026

https://github.com/1337hero/worktree-switcher

Git WorkTree Switcher (gwt): Streamline Your Git Workflow

git github shell shell-script worktrees

Last synced: 07 May 2026

https://github.com/vagnerbellacosa/wifi_linhadecomandos

Arquivinhos bat para monitorar a rede wifi. Testes de performance e qualidade de sinal

bat batch-script command-line ipconfig netsh rede shell wifi windows

Last synced: 16 Apr 2026

https://github.com/miozilla/redhatcentos

redhatcentos :coin::hot_pepper::tophat: : Cloud SDK Virtual Machine | Red Hat Enterprise Level (RHEL) 9, CentOS 9, RPM, yum |

bash centos9 cli command console gcloud linux package redhat repo shell stream vm

Last synced: 03 Jun 2026

https://github.com/jwszolek/accelerated-data-generator

Ultra-fast random data generator. It gives you an ability to generate almost 1M of rows in around second.

bash csv data data-generator generator shell

Last synced: 02 Apr 2026

https://github.com/viveksb007/rest-based-shell

This project emulates the shell using REST

kotlin rest-api shell spark-java

Last synced: 16 Apr 2026

https://github.com/moisutsu/lsh-rust

Rustによる簡易シェルLSHの移植

lsh rust shell

Last synced: 17 Apr 2026

https://github.com/sypher93/right-click-file

Convenient feature that adds a contextual option to the right-click menu on Ubuntu (GNOME) to quickly create a file.

debian gnome linux python3 shell ubuntu

Last synced: 03 Mar 2026

https://github.com/tiawl-archives/modernish_supported_shells

Project that needs to be fixed but I do not want to work more on it

alpine ash bash busybox busybox-ash dash docker mksh sh shell yash zsh

Last synced: 06 Mar 2026

https://github.com/kyleyannelli/sh-bot

sh-bot is a Go-based Discord bot that can automate sh scripts by monitoring user activity on Discord.

discord discord-bot discordgo golang scripting shell

Last synced: 17 Apr 2026

https://github.com/nyxnor/scripts

Miscellaneous files to help you write smart shell scripts

getopt getopts miscellaneous-scripts posix posix-shell shell shell-script shellscript shellscript-tutorials

Last synced: 09 Oct 2025

https://github.com/elo-enterprises/shil

Parser/formatter/pprinter for shell code

python shell

Last synced: 02 Jun 2026

https://github.com/thinhngotony/alias

Hyber Alias - One command. All your shell aliases. Everywhere. Cross-platform alias manager for Git, Kubernetes, and system operations.

aliases bash cross-platform dotfiles powershell productivity shell zsh

Last synced: 02 Apr 2026